Abstract
Reconfigurable intelligent surface (RIS) has become a promising solution to improve the performance of future wireless systems with low energy consumptions. Concerning a RIS-aided or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) system, we perform optimization with respect to the RIS passive beamforming such that the sum rate over all subcarriers is maximized. Different from an existing successive convex approximation (SCA) method, we propose a majorization-minimization (MM)-based iterative approach to optimize the RIS passive beamforming, where a closed-form solution is obtained in each iteration. Simulation results show that the proposed RIS passive beamforming achieves almost the same performance as the SCA-based method while with much lower computational complexity.
